St. John Bosco hosts terrific 32-team tournament

July 1, 2012 By Frank Burlison 1 Comment

  • Tweet
  • Tweet

BELLFLOWER, Ca. – What shapes up as one of the elite Southern California hoops events of the summer will get under way Monday afternoon, with St. John Bosco High serving as the event’s headquarters.

The 32-team, Braves Varsity Summer Classic will be played in four prep gyms over the course of five days (no games will be played on July 4), with the championship game set for Saturday afternoon, 3 o’clock, at SJB.

Besides the host school, games will also be played at Compton Dominguez, Lakewood St. Joseph and Redondo Beach Redondo Union.

For complete schedules and daily results, go to the tournament website at http://www.HTOsports.com/boscobraveshoops.

The teams are divided into eight pools, with teach team getting three “pool-play” games before the event goes into tournament format.

The top seeds in the respective pools are St. John Bosco (A), Santa Ana Mater Dei (B), L.A. Westchester (C), Pasadena (D), Gardena Serra (E), Inglewood (F), Compton (G) and Bishop Montgomery (H).

Based upon action in June tournament actions, Bishop Montgomery is likely the pre-tournament favorite.

The Knights won tournaments at Compton High (beating the host Tarbabes in the final) and Westchester (knocking off the host Comets Saturday night).
